The Hidden Environmental expense of guide-acid: Why Older Technologies Don't Fit a Green long run

though guide-acid batteries have powered automobiles for decades, their environmental footprint can not be disregarded. This recognized technology, the moment a cornerstone of industrial and automotive energy, presents important challenges within an era demanding heightened environmental accountability.

To begin with, the pollution threats connected to lead-acid batteries are significant. These batteries incorporate large metals, primarily lead, and corrosive sulfuric acid. inappropriate disposal or recycling may lead to extreme contamination of soil and water resources, posing considerable threats to ecosystems and human wellbeing. The mining and processing of lead also lead to air and water pollution, click here embedding an environmental load even ahead of the battery reaches its very first use.

Next, direct-acid batteries have problems with inherent Power inefficiency. Their somewhat very low Electrical power conversion prices mean that a good portion of your Electricity utilized for charging is missing as heat. This inefficiency translates to a lot more Regular charging cycles and an increased All round energy use within the grid, indirectly increasing the carbon emissions associated with their Procedure.

last but not least, the brief lifespan and subsequent disposal issues of lead-acid batteries produce a cyclical environmental burden. With a typical lifespan of just a few several years, they demand Regular substitution, leading to a large accumulation of discarded batteries. While recycling initiatives exist, the Vitality-intense approach as well as the issues of managing harmful components indicate that lead-acid batteries constantly contribute to squander streams and environmental pressure during their lifecycle.

LiFePO₄’s environmentally friendly Advantage: Powering Progress with Environmental Integrity

The core of a sustainable long run lies in adopting technologies that intrinsically align with environmental preservation. Lithium iron phosphate (LiFePO₄) batteries offer a compelling eco-friendly edge above their direct-acid predecessors, addressing vital environmental issues although offering excellent performance.

Chemical basic safety and Non-Polluting character:

A essential distinction lies within their chemical composition. LiFePO₄ batteries are totally free from hazardous hefty metals such as direct, nickel, and cobalt, and they eliminate the chance of acid leaks. This inherent chemical security can make them appreciably safer for each Procedure and disposal. Their non-toxic nature makes certain that even at the conclusion of their exceptionally lengthy life, they pose a nominal danger towards the natural environment, making them A really responsible choice for assorted programs, from higher-overall performance electric powered autos to sensitive marine environments and household Electricity storage techniques. The absence of risky substances also improves protection in enclosed Areas or large-temperature scenarios, decreasing fire risks and creating them a most popular selection where by operational security and environmental security are paramount.

Electricity Efficiency and prolonged Lifespan:

LiFePO₄ batteries boast a significantly outstanding Electricity conversion charge as compared to lead-acid. Their steady discharge properties be sure that more stored Electricity is shipped as usable electric power, minimizing Electrical power waste. This heightened effectiveness not just reduces operational costs but additionally lowers the overall Strength footprint of the run gadget or method. More drastically, LiFePO₄ batteries give a drastically for a longer time cycle lifestyle – frequently ten times that of lead-acid counterparts. This prolonged lifespan directly interprets into fewer battery replacements as time passes, dramatically minimizing the quantity of discarded batteries and For that reason lowering the carbon footprint affiliated with manufacturing, delivery, and recycling new units. This longevity is usually a cornerstone of their environmental superiority, embodying the basic principle of "cut down, reuse, recycle" by minimizing the "decrease" Consider use.

diminished servicing and source Conservation:

made for "set it and fail to remember it" comfort, LiFePO₄ batteries involve virtually no servicing. contrary to lead-acid batteries That usually have to have periodic water refilling or terminal cleaning, LiFePO₄ systems are sealed and upkeep-cost-free. This characteristic not merely will save time and labor but also helps prevent the environmental problems associated with electrolyte spills. Also, their extended support daily life signifies that fewer batteries have to be produced and transported around a supplied period of time. This reduction in manufacturing and logistics cycles directly conserves Uncooked products and Strength, contributing to a substantial decrease in overall source consumption and environmental effect. routinely questioned thoughts (FAQ) about LiFePO₄ Batteries:

Are LiFePO₄ batteries actually safer than lead-acid? Yes, Unquestionably. LiFePO₄ chemistry is inherently additional secure, minimizing the risk of thermal runaway, and they do not include toxic hefty metals or corrosive acids, creating them significantly safer in operation and disposal.

How much longer do LiFePO₄ batteries previous compared to lead-acid? Typically, LiFePO₄ batteries provide five to ten periods the cycle lifetime of common lead-acid batteries, Long lasting for Countless cycles in comparison with hundreds for lead-acid.

Are LiFePO₄ batteries costlier upfront? although the Original expense for LiFePO₄ batteries may be bigger, their much longer lifespan, higher performance, and zero routine maintenance prerequisites bring about a substantially decrease total expense of ownership over their operational daily life.

Can I substitute my lead-acid battery that has a LiFePO₄ battery? In many cases, yes. LiFePO₄ batteries in many cases are made as drop-in replacements for lead-acid batteries, even though it is important to make certain compatibility together with your existing charging process or consult that has a professional.

Exactly what are the first apps for LiFePO₄ batteries? These are greatly Utilized in electric motor vehicles (golfing carts, RVs, maritime), solar Electrical power storage, uninterruptible energy materials (UPS), and several industrial purposes due to their general performance and longevity.
